Ottawa grabs last-ditch win over Edmonton

-

OTTAWA — Chris Milo kicked a 25-yard field goal with 1:34 to play to lift the Ottawa Redblacks to a 23-20 win over the Edmonton Eskimos on Saturday.

A 48-yard intercepti­on return by Jermaine Robinson set up Milo’s third field goal of the game.

Robinson’s intercepti­on off a Mike Reilly pass came seconds after a Redblacks touchdown that tied the game 20-20 with 2:28 remaining in the fourth quarter.

Prior to that, JC Sherritt intercepte­d a Henry Burris pass and returned the ball 43 yards for a touchdown.

Burris’s pass hit the foot of intended receiver Chris Williams and bounced high into the air before landing in the arms of Sherritt. The two point conversion put the Eskimos ahead 20-13, their first lead of the game.

The Redblacks followed that up with a drive that ended in a six-yard touchdown pass from Burris to Williams that tied the game at 12:32.

Burris went 26-of-39 passing for 341 yards with two TDs and an intercepti­on. Reilly was 25-of41 passing for 255 yards and one pick. Sean Whyte booted three field goals for the Eskimos, who also got points from a punt single and a safety.

The win snapped a two-game losing streak for the Redblacks (4-2-1), who now head into a bye week. The Eskimos (2-4) suffered their third consecutiv­e defeat.

Burris opened the game with a nice drive that included five completed passes and 74 total yards, but on third and one the Redblacks had to settle for a Milo 17-yard field goal.

That was it for scoring in the first quarter until Ottawa kicker Zackary Medeiros elected to concede a safety on the last play of the quarter rather than punt from his own end zone.

After Whyte missed a 50-yard field goal on the opening drive of the second quarter, the Redblacks took over and Burris marched his team 91 yards down field, ending the drive with the touchdown pass to Jackson five minutes in.

Milo converted the score, but much of the success on the drive came from Greg Ellingson.
